Getting to Your Tamworth Accommodation

Tamworth's position in the heart of England puts it within easy reach of several major transport hubs. Many visitors to the area choose to arrive by car, and having your own vehicle certainly offers you the flexibility to explore at your own pace. Tamworth is close to the M42, M6 and M1 motorways, all of which provide links to London, Manchester and beyond.

If you'd prefer to let the train take the strain, the town's station has direct services from London, Manchester and Lancaster. A more flexible option might be to connect via Birmingham New Street on the West Coast Main Line. From Birmingham, it's only 19 minutes on a local service to Tamworth.

Tamworth is midway between two large airports, Birmingham International and East Midlands Airport. Both airports offer a range of domestic and international departures. From the airport, hire a car or get a taxi for the 40 minute drive into Tamworth.

Where to eat in Tamworth

Tamworth town centre offers a mix of the popular chain restaurants and pubs you'd find in most British towns, alongside independent bistros and bars. If you're self-catering in Tamworth, then the thrice-weekly market, held unsurprisingly on Market Street, is the perfect place to stock up on provisions. There are also several town-centre supermarkets which are open from early in the morning to late at night.

If you'd prefer to let someone else do the cooking, then this part of England is famous for its curry culture. New arrivals from the Indian subcontinent in the 1960s brought their cuisine with them, and now dishes like Chicken Tikka Masala often top the list of Britain's favourite dishes. Try the Royal Bengal in Lichfield Street, which specialises in seafood.

Soak up the traditional pub atmosphere at the Wigginton, a Tamworth pub famous for its no-nonsense pub grub and welcoming atmosphere. The menu has all the classics like steak, burgers, scampi or all day breakfast, ideally washed down with a pint of local beer. Kids are welcome too, with a fully customisable children's menu to ensure everyone's happy.

Family Holidays in Tamworth

Tamworth's location right in the centre of England makes it the ideal choice for a break spent exploring with the family. Choose from a range of bed and breakfast accommodation, hotels, or select a self-catering holiday let for that home away from home experience. Larger properties on the edges of town are ideal for families, and often have the benefit of a large enclosed garden for the kids to play in.

If your kids are active types, then an afternoon at Cliff Lakes should allow them to burn off some excess energy. Try paddle boarding, wake boarding or the thrilling obstacle course, and if parents are feeling brave they can join in too. There's also a cafe and woodland walks should you prefer the idea of a more sedate afternoon out.

A few miles away from Tamworth is the National Memorial Arboretum in Burton-On-Trent, featuring over 30,000 trees and some stunning outdoor art installations and sculptures. It might not be the obvious choice for a family day out, but the 150 acre site is packed with things to see and do. Regular events, talks and exhibitions cover all aspects of conflict and remembrance. Young kids, meanwhile, will love the adventure trail around the site, with stops at the play area.

What to See and Do in Tamworth

Tamworth is home to one of Britain's best-known theme parks, Drayton Manor. The park offers high-octane roller coasters and thrill rides to delight older kids and teens, and the more sedate Thomas Land featuring everyone's favourite steam engine for little adventurers. There is also a zoo with tigers, meerkats, monkeys and many more amazing species. Drayton Manor has so much to see and do that it makes sense to pre-book the two day pass so you can really explore all the attractions that this world-class family entertainment hub has to offer.

If you're more interested in history than thrill rides, don't miss Tamworth Castle in the centre of the town. Journey through over 900 years of history as you make your way through the courtyards and rooms, each of which showcases a different era in the castle's history. Costumed guides are on hand to tell visitors all about the sieges and ghosts, or to point out hidden features you may otherwise miss.

One of Tamworth's more unusual attractions is the Snow Dome. Here, visitors can ski, snowboard, ice skate and toboggan, whatever the weather outside. Book a lesson if you're new to the sport, or brush up on your snowploughs or half-pipes if you're not. Climbing facilities and swimming pools are also on site.
